Gooey Cinnamon Cream Cheese Muffins


  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Description

These Gooey Cinnamon Cream Cheese Muffins are a delightful treat, featuring a soft and fluffy muffin base filled with a rich cream cheese center and topped with a sweet cinnamon sugar crust. Perfect for breakfast or a snack!


Ingredients

Scale

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
1 cup granulated sugar
2 large e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up milk
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up powdered sugar
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 cup brown sugar


Instructions

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
Add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, alternating with the milk, and mix until just combined.
In another bowl, beat together the soft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and cinnamon until smooth.
Fill each muffin cup halfway with the batter, then add a spoonful of the cream cheese mixture on top, followed by another layer of muffin batter to cover.
Sprinkle the tops with brown sugar for added sweetness and crunch.
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Allow the muffins to cool in the pan for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
